**Alert: BranchWarden cleanup anomaly**

BranchWarden is the automated bot that deletes branches inactive for more than 90 days across Hollygate repositories. This alert fires when the bot deletes more than 50 branches in a single run or touches any branch matching a protected pattern. Both conditions may indicate a misconfigured allowlist or compromised bot credentials, so treat unexpected triggers as potential security events. Review the run manifest, then report findings to the address below.

escalation mailbox, hadug-bajog: sormir@norvalabs.internal

Subject: Kestrel Dynamics term sheet — quick read for finance

Team, the revised term sheet from Kestrel Dynamics landed yesterday and it's largely in our favour. They've dropped the minimum volume commitment, accepted quarterly true-ups, and agreed to a 60-day payment window. The one open item is currency hedging on the Averlane contract — finance, please model both scenarios before Friday's call. If this closes, it reshapes next year's channel forecast considerably. The confidential planning note that explains why sits just below.

confidential, kagup-bafog: Fraaxax Group is in early talks to buy Soroxox Group for about $343.8 million. The Olidor launch date is June 14, and nothing goes to the press before then. Legal wants the Aldmirek Logistics term sheet signed before July 23.

Audit Checklist — Item 14: Dependency Graph Visualizer (Mapwick)

Support team: verify that the Mapwick visualizer renders the full dependency graph for customer projects without truncation, that cycle warnings display in red, and that the export-to-image function produces legible output at 500+ nodes. Confirm the cached graph refreshes within 15 minutes of a manifest change, and log any stale-data reports as severity-two. Escalations on this item route to the accountable engineer named below.

approver of bagaf-hahif = Casok Jorael Quenys Rusdor